Rob Gronkowski, Paul Bissonnette trade barbs over dating apps, ‘bro code’
TNT Sports’ Jackie Redmond interviewed Rob Gronkowski throughout Game 2 of the Stanley Cup Playoffs sequence between the Montreal Canadiens and Buffalo Sabers on Friday night time, and Gronkowski did not maintain again when speaking about TNT analyst Paul Bissonnette.
Gronkowski, a former NFL star tight finish and present Fox Sports NFL analyst, instructed Redmond about Bissonnette, “Biz Nasty, I’ve got a little bone to pick with you. He’s matching with our high school friends on dating apps right now.”

Redmond laughed earlier than saying, “Oh my god!”
“Yeah, I know. I know what you’re up to,” Gronkowski continued along with his message for Bissonnette. “You’re swiping left all over the place, and you’re matching with our friends. We’re going to have a problem.”
Bissonnette made quite a few posts in response on X, and he even referenced the saga involving NFL reporter Dianna Russini and New England Patriots head coach Mike Vrabel in an try to mock Gronkowski, a Patriots legend.
During the sport’s second intermission on the NHL on TNT studio present, Bissonnette addressed Gronkowski’s feedback.
“Right in the junk,” Bissonnette stated. “Right in the junk. You worry about your old Patriot crew there, Rob. You want to talk about game, I’m gonna bring it in the ring. I’ll see you at Rough N’ Rowdy, pal. You keep your mouth shut! A little bro code in there! Holy cow! My god! I’m gonna bring all the skeletons out of your closet, Rob! Wait and see, buddy!”
